The Rosberg family - and indeed many race fans - took a fine trip down memory lane in Monaco on Thursday.

The father and son world champion combo treated everyone to an emotional few laps of nostalgia onboard their respective F1 championship winning cars.

World champion Keke Rosberg - all suited and booted in period overalls, and wearing a genuine 1980 bell helmet - drove his 1982 Williams FW07C for the first time in over 35 years, flanked by 2016 title winner Nico Rosberg in his Mercedes W06.

Beyond the sheer excitement of watching the family roar its way around the Principality, the demo was also a reminder of how good a Grand Prix car looked - and sounded - almost four decades ago.
